Output 7e955d4ae771956f63a29fe430e8db5b52fb13681f930f4bed585dde3260df95:6

value
16421077
script pubkey
OP_0 OP_PUSHBYTES_20 d307cb2f5908da6e0ee74ecf5b9c7b0248c76d2d
address
ltc1q6vrukt6eprdxurh8fm84h8rmqfyvwmfdykzsz9
transaction
7e955d4ae771956f63a29fe430e8db5b52fb13681f930f4bed585dde3260df95
spent
true